AtoM development model and user community | Jessica | Canadian company Artefactual's model is similar Drupal community (open source software freely available for deployment, but you can contract with company for customizations, support, hosting; new features are integrated into subsequent releases of the software). Dunbarton Oaks, a DC repository affiliated with Harvard has been using AtoM for awhile: relatively small set of data for migration; positive experience with tech support/forum; contracting for image cataloging tool/VRA core module SAA AtoM interest group is in the works Recommendation that we compile our questions and post them to the forum so that the wider community benefits from the answers/convo |

Top Atom customization requests:
Section | Fix needed | Estimated difficulty | Priority |
---|---|---|---|
EAD EXPORT | EAD export needs to use our TARO stylesheet. Also, current output doesn't necessarily validate. | Low | High |
ACCESSIONS | Accession record numbering is automated and doesn't adhere to our numbering system-can the number field be made editable? | Medium | High |
PHYSICAL STORAGE | If under "Manage Physical Storage" we could add searchable information such as "3 in. space for photos" or "Shelf space for 3 oversize boxes," we could replace our current shelflist with Atom | High | High |
ACCESSIONS | Archival descriptions must be linked to accession records upon creation. You can't link descriptions to accessions after the fact. | Medium | Medium |
ARCHIVAL DESCRIPTION | Scope notes that appear on the data entry fields are not terribly helpful. Can this text be customized? | Medium | Medium |
ARCHIVAL DESCRIPTION | Every child level of arrangement has the same data entry fields. Can this be streamlined and duplicative fields removed? | Medium | Medium |
ARCHIVAL DESCRIPTION | Each level in the hierarchy demands a unique identifier, but the uniqueness isn't enforced. Similarly, "required fields" aren't actually enforced. | Medium | Low |
EAD EXPORT | Some kind of preview/print functionality within Atom would be nice so that we can spot errors before uploading our files to TARO. | High | Low |
ARCHIVAL DESCRIPTION | There isn't a one to one relationship between some Atom fields and TARO template. Where do we enter OCLC # and preferred citation? Can those fields be added to Atom? | Medium | Low |
MARC EXPORT | A feature that allows mapping the Archival Description into a MARC record is not a priority, but could be an eventual nice addition. | High | Low |
